There could be instances like a war that is currently happening or being born in an era that has lead in house paint that could influence a child's physical development. War could lead to starvation or malnutrition which can stunt growth. As for lead, before the 1970s, lead had been added to paint for centuries. Long term exposure to certain levels of lead can also stunt growth and cause other health effects (look up on ur own).
On July 28, 1868, the 14th Amendment to the United States Constitution was ratified. The amendment grants citizenship to "all persons born or naturalized in the United States" which included former slaves who had just been freed after the Civil War.
